-
Borland Socket Server
Bonjour,
J’essaie de faire fonctionner en service le Borland Socket Server sur Windows Serveur 8 R2 64 B et Seven pro pack 1 64 b.
J'ai le message Windows n'a pu démarrer le service sur l'ordinateur local.
J'utilise le Borland Socket Server livré avec Delphi7
J'ai essayé les modes de compatibilités sans succès.
Il parvient à se lancer en tant que service mais au démarrage du poste, il ne se lance pas ??
Comment le faire fonctionner en service sans avoir l’exécuter manuellement ?
merci
Cyril
-
Delphi 7 produit des services Win32 !
Je ne sais pas si c'est propre d'installer un service 32Bits sur un OS 64 Bits
Pense que les règles de droits et d'interactivité sont de pire en pire !
Un TrayIcon peut poser ce genre de problème
Peut-être faudrait fournir un compte au service (ça lui donnera des droits qui lui manque peut-être)
Code:
sc.exe config ServiceName obj=... password=...
En général, j'installe toujours mes services avec soit un compte utilisateur (si j'ai pas mieux) ou un compte dédié avec les droits utiles (Interactif, Droit de Créer d'autres processus ...)
"Borland Socket Server" ?
C'est TServerSocket de ScktComp ?
Ils ont eu leur période difficile, un moment déclaré comme obsolète mais toujours présent et maintenu !
C'est TTCPServer de Sockets ?
-
merci de ta réponse.
J'utilise le TSocketConnection se trouvant dans la palette DataSnap.
J'ai essayé :
1°) Je suis dans une session ou je suis administrateur du poste
2°) J'ai sélectionné le service scktsrvr.exe.J'ai testé différent mode de compatibilité, et exécuter le programme en tant qu'administrateur.
3°) scktsrvr.exe" –install
4°) Il s'est bien installer mais n'a pas démarrer.
5°) J'ai réussi à le démarrer en mode manuel.
6°) Je reboote le PC et là au démarrage, il ne se lance pas.
Je continue mes tests et toujours preneur d'idées.
merci
A+
-
j'ai utilisé le borland socket server de XE2.
Cela a permis de résoudre le problème.